本人按着网上的说法,在datastage中安装了mysql的odbc驱动,所有都安装好的时候,测试连接却出现了错误,检查了很多遍都没发现错误在什么地方,下面是报错信息,求大神们相助图片说明](https://img-ask.csdn.net/upload/201510/26/1445852390_379861.png)
本人现在没有币了,求相助!
本人按着网上的说法,在datastage中安装了mysql的odbc驱动,所有都安装好的时候,测试连接却出现了错误,检查了很多遍都没发现错误在什么地方,下面是报错信息,求大神们相助图片说明](https://img-ask.csdn.net/upload/201510/26/1445852390_379861.png)
本人现在没有币了,求相助!
以下回答参考 皆我百晓生、券券喵儿 等免费微信小程序相关内容作答,并由本人整理回复。
根据您提供的信息,这似乎是一个数据源连接问题。在尝试使用ODBC驱动程序与MySQL数据库进行连接时,遇到的问题可能是由于未正确配置ODBC驱动或MySQL服务器端未能响应。
为了解决此问题,请按照以下步骤操作:
首先确认您已经成功安装了MySQL ODBC驱动。如果之前有安装过但出现过问题,可以尝试卸载并重新安装。您可以访问MySQL官方文档在这里下载最新版本的ODBC驱动程序。
确保您的datastage.properties文件中包含正确的ODBC驱动路径和用户名密码。如果您是在部署环境中运行的数据阶段,则可能需要修改datastage.properties以匹配环境变量。例如,对于Windows系统,您可以在C:\Program Files\IBM\DataStage\bin目录下找到ODBC驱动的配置文件,并将其中的jdbc.jdbcurl替换为您实际使用的数据库URL(包括驱动名称)。
确保MySQL服务正在正常运行。您可以通过执行以下命令来检查MySQL服务的状态:
sudo systemctl status mysql
如果服务状态显示为“active (running)”或者“active (starting)”,那么说明MySQL服务是正常的。
尝试通过其他方式验证MySQL服务器是否可用,比如ping一下MySQL服务器地址(例如:localhost)。如果能够ping通,说明MySQL服务应该可以正常工作。
如果以上步骤都无法解决问题,您可能需要进一步排查MySQL服务器端的问题,例如查看日志文件、重启MySQL服务等。同时,考虑到您当前没有币的情况,建议您联系技术支持人员寻求进一步的帮助,他们可能会提供更具体的解决方案。
请注意,这些步骤仅供参考,具体的操作方法可能因您的操作系统和数据阶段版本而异。希望这些建议能帮到您!